我正在使用Angular Material添加菜单。我得到了下面的代码,但是我使用(click)事件将所选年份传递给打字稿,以设置selectedYear。在我的上一个项目中,我将常规引导程序与[(ngModel)]一起使用。我通过angular.material.io网站阅读,没有看到将ngModel绑定到Year菜单选择的任何示例。我确实看到了,但这与垫选项有关。有没有一种方法可以使用ngModel归档更清洁的Angular代码,并避免需要调用函数来设置选择内容?谢谢
<mat-menu #yearMenu="matMenu" [overlapTrigger]="false">
<button mat-menu-item (click)="OnClickedYear(year)" class="bread-crumb-mat-menu-item" *ngFor="let year of years"> {{year}} </button>
</mat-menu>
<button mat-button [matMenuTriggerFor]="yearMenu" class="bread-crumb">{{selectedYear}}<mat-icon>expand_more</mat-icon></button>